Common Gutter Maintenance Jobs
Gutter Cleaning - removing debris and buildup to ensure proper water flow.
Gutter Inspection - checking for damage, leaks, and blockages that could cause water issues.
Gutter Repair - fixing leaks, loose brackets, and damaged sections to maintain functionality.
Gutter Guard Installation - adding screens or covers to prevent debris accumulation and reduce maintenance.
Downspout Maintenance - clearing and repairing downspouts to direct water away from the foundation.
Gutter Replacement - installing new gutters when existing systems are beyond repair or age-related.
Gutter Maintenance Questions
How often should gutters be maintained? Regular inspections and cleaning are recommended at least twice a year to prevent blockages and water damage.
What signs indicate gutter problems? Overflowing water, sagging gutters, or visible debris buildup are common signs that maintenance may be needed.
Can gutter maintenance prevent property damage? Yes, keeping gutters clear helps prevent water from seeping into the foundation, siding, or roof structure.
What types of debris are typically removed during maintenance? Leaves, twigs, dirt, and other organic materials are commonly cleared to ensure proper water flow.
